Violin SKU: FZ.5813 Serie II - France 1800-1860. Edited by Nicolas Fromageot. This edition: Facsimile. Methodes & Traites. Score. Published by Anne Fuzeau Productions - France (FZ.5813). ISBN 9790230658133. 24.00 x 33.00 cm inches.These early music methods are in facsimile in six books. Jacques-Fereol MAZAS. Methode de violon suivie d'un traite des sons harmoniques en simple ou double-cordes (Paris, Aulagnier, s. d. = 1830). Collection supervised by the musicologist Jean Saint-Arroman, professor at the Conservatoire National Superieur de Musique et de Danse of Paris and at the CEFEDEM Ile de France (Training Centre for Music Teachers). He is the author of the majority of our prefaces and has also been involved in library searches. Facsimile of a copy in the National Library of Paris (France).
